FREE WILL

Daily untold numbers of choices
we each make
pertaining to a wide variety of
activities we selectively undertake,
some we make almost instantaneously
while others may require lengthy thought
the rest fall somewhere in-between
or may not be made at all.

Many are the ways in which
our choices may be made
most, hopefully are ours alone to make,
unencumbered by command, instruction
or other societal contractual necessities
to which we had given our consent
thus in most cases a necessity are
to our very lives and our well being.

True free choices may be much more
limited than we think
wisely we should chose while carefully
exploring the paths that we seek,
be considerate of others
mindful of the consequences
of ripple effects and boomerangs
hasty, poor choices oft result in
dire consequences
for you, your loved ones
your home, your work, your town
or even society as a whole.
